BREVARD COUNTY, FLORIDA – This afternoon, I am extremely pleased to announce that the two suspects wanted in connection with the February 18 carjacking on I-95 in Titusville, have been arrested and are now sitting behind bars where they belong.

The investigation began on February 18, when two suspects unsuccessfully attempted to carjack a vehicle from a victim at the BP Gas Station located at 3460 Garden Street in Titusville.

The suspects then traveled to the Executive Garden Hotel at 3480 Garden Street, at which time they successfully carjacked a second victim, resulting in the victim sustaining substantial physical injuries requiring hospitalization.

During the second carjacking, the suspects stole the victim’s Dodge Ram Pick-up truck and fled onto I-95 where they crashed into a semi-truck.

The suspects then fled from the disabled vehicle and carjacked another victim who stopped to render aid, after witnessing the traffic crash. The suspects again used physical force to obtain this victim’s vehicle and fled the area.

As the investigation continued Agents with the North Precinct General Crimes Unit were able to identify both the suspects and obtain arrest warrants that were signed by a Brevard County Judge for their arrest.

As a result, 25-year-old Lanorris Habersham, of Pompano Beach, was arrested on February 20 in Louisville, Georgia.

She has subsequently been extradited back to Brevard County where he is currently incarcerated in the Brevard County Jail with No Bond.

In addition, 26 year-old Jalen Smith, of Pompano Beach, was arrested on March 5 by the U.S. Marshall’s Task Force, which the Brevard County Sheriff’s Office is an active member in Swainsboro, Georgia.

Smith is currently awaiting extradition back to Brevard County as both suspects face charges of Carjacking and Violation of Probation.

The arrests were made possible through the cooperative effort of the Sheriff’s Office North Precinct General Crimes Unit, the GAMEOVER Task Force and U.S Marshall’s Task Force.

The Sheriff’s Office is also working closely with the Titusville Police Department and other law enforcement agencies who are conducting investigations relating to these two suspects.
